Factors Affecting Total Cost
Installing an elderly shower in Durham, CT, involves selecting appropriate materials, understanding the scope of work, and considering necessary permits. These projects aim to improve safety and accessibility while fitting within typical home renovation budgets. Understanding the key aspects can help in planning and comparing options for elderly shower installations.
- Materials: Options include acrylic, fiberglass, or tile surrounds designed for durability and ease of cleaning.
- Size and Scope: Common shower sizes range from standard 36x36 inches to larger, accessible designs that accommodate mobility aids.
- Labor Complexity: Installation complexity varies based on existing bathroom layout, plumbing adjustments, and accessibility features.
- Permitting: Local regulations in Durham may require permits for bathroom modifications, especially when plumbing or structural changes are involved.
- Extras: Additional features such as grab bars, low-threshold entries, or seating can be included to enhance safety and accessibility.
